Where is El Corozal?
Where is El Corozal located?
El Corozal, Puerto Plata, The Dominican Republic (approx. 19.76667°, -70.75°)
Where is El Corozal on the map?
El Corozal - Sabana del Coroso
El Corozal - La Sabana
El Corozal - Barcelo Bavaro Beach - Adults Only
El Corozal - La Berenice
El Corozal - Los Iyos
El Corozal - Hotel Juanmar
El Corozal - Airport Internacional Almirante Padilla (Rioacha)
El Corozal - El Corozal
El Corozal - Guanaroca River
El Corozal - Hotel Geejam
{"latitude":19.76667,"longitude":-70.75,"title":"El Corozal"}